Output 342db067c87feb8e53e4c4e5374957908ef6dc9d92fd1c39c05d930a6df1ae68:26

value
151835
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89cb96daa53795fd9a5e24269a584849fb88764e OP_EQUALVERIFY OP_CHECKSIG
address
1DZbTusHEGXWENTfApDoyxZ2yC5y1FZwDy
transaction
342db067c87feb8e53e4c4e5374957908ef6dc9d92fd1c39c05d930a6df1ae68